Q&A: Understanding Syria's uprising (AP) Posted: 02 Mar 2012 09:59 PM PST AP - After weeks of bloody siege, Syrian troops have moved into one of the most restive neighborhoods of Homs, one of the cities at the center of the country's uprising against President Bashar Assad. The Red Cross is preparing to move in, and opposition activists accuse troops of carrying out a scorched-earth campaign of reprisals in the district, called Baba Amr. |

U.N. report: Human rights abuses continue in Libya Posted: 02 Mar 2012 08:48 PM PST Forces loyal to Libyan leader Moammar Gaddafi carried out mass executions and tortured suspected regime opponents, amounting to crimes against humanity, while the anti-Gaddafi militias now governing the country carried out war crimes, according to a year-long inquiry by a U.N. commission. Red Cross blocked by Syria from ex-rebel enclave (AP) Posted: 02 Mar 2012 08:00 PM PST AP - The Syrian government blocked a Red Cross convoy Friday from delivering badly needed food, medical supplies and blankets to a rebellious neighborhood of Homs cut off by a monthlong siege, and activists accused regime troops who overran the shattered district of execution-style killings and a scorched-earth campaign. |
